The Movement of Anabaptist Women Doing Theology from Latin America, or MTAL, celebrated its 20th anniversary with a workshop in El Salvador on April 14-16.
Eduardo “Lalo” Hinojosa, 81, a pastor influential in the growth of Mennonite congregations in Brownsville and the South Texas border region, died June 3 in Houston.
Mennonite World Conference’s Executive Committee accepted churches from Tananzia and Ukraine as new members and approved funding for theological education during meetings April 8-11 in Curitiba, Brazil.
Tina Warkentin Bohn, 95, whose diverse mission assignments spanned four continents and 38 years, died April 11 in Goshen, Ind.
Attorneys general from at least 20 states have filed amicus briefs in support of Amish schools’ religious freedom in rural New York.
